| Name | Description | Type | Package | Framework |
| AbstractComponentCallback | Base class for most implementations of ComponentCallback, used when there is an underlying Event. | Class | org.apache.tapestry5.internal.structure | Apache Tapestry |
| BlockImpl | Class | org.apache.tapestry5.internal.structure | Apache Tapestry | |
| BodyPageElement | A type of page element that has a body that can be added to. | Interface | org.apache.tapestry5.internal.structure | Apache Tapestry |
| ComponentCallback | Callback interface, used when invoking lifecycle methods on components. | Interface | org.apache.tapestry5.internal.structure | Apache Tapestry |
| ComponentPageElement | Interface | org.apache.tapestry5.internal.structure | Apache Tapestry | |
| ComponentPageElementImpl | element's behavior is delegated to user code, via a Component instance. | Class | org.apache.tapestry5.internal.structure | Apache Tapestry |
| ComponentPageElementResources | Provides access to common methods of various services, needed by implementations of ComponentPageElement and InternalComponentResources. | Interface | org.apache.tapestry5.internal.structure | Apache Tapestry |
| ComponentPageElementResourcesImpl | Class | org.apache.tapestry5.internal.structure | Apache Tapestry | |
| ComponentPageElementResourcesSource | Provides access to the ComponentPageElementResources facade. | Interface | org.apache.tapestry5.internal.structure | Apache Tapestry |
| ComponentPageElementResourcesSourceImpl | Class | org.apache.tapestry5.internal.structure | Apache Tapestry | |
| ExpansionPageElement | Class | org.apache.tapestry5.internal.structure | Apache Tapestry | |
| InternalComponentResourcesImpl | The bridge between a component and its ComponentPageElement, that supplies all kinds of component, including access to its parameters, parameter bindings, and persistent field data. | Class | org.apache.tapestry5.internal.structure | Apache Tapestry |
| LifecycleNotificationComponentCallback | that do not have an event, and can therefore never be aborted. | Class | org.apache.tapestry5.internal.structure | Apache Tapestry |
| Page | Represents a unique page within the application. | Interface | org.apache.tapestry5.internal.structure | Apache Tapestry |
| Page .Stats | Page construction statistics for the page. | Class | org.apache.tapestry5.internal.structure.Page | Apache Tapestry |
| PageImpl | Nested Class SummaryNested classes/interfaces inherited from interface org. | Class | org.apache.tapestry5.internal.structure | Apache Tapestry |
| PageResetListener | Optional interface implemented to support resetting of the page state. | Interface | org.apache.tapestry5.internal.structure | Apache Tapestry |
| RenderPhaseEvent | Fields inherited from class org. | Class | org.apache.tapestry5.internal.structure | Apache Tapestry |